Urovo Technology Co., Ltd.'s (SZSE:300531) Popularity With Investors Under Threat As Stock Sinks 29%

Simply Wall St ·  Jan 31 19:27

The Urovo Technology Co., Ltd. (SZSE:300531) share price has fared very poorly over the last month, falling by a substantial 29%. The drop over the last 30 days has capped off a tough year for shareholders, with the share price down 25% in that time.

Although its price has dipped substantially, given around half the companies in China have price-to-earnings ratios (or "P/E's") below 29x, you may still consider Urovo Technology as a stock to potentially avoid with its 33x P/E ratio. Although, it's not wise to just take the P/E at face value as there may be an explanation why it's as high as it is.

For example, consider that Urovo Technology's financial performance has been poor lately as its earnings have been in decline. One possibility is that the P/E is high because investors think the company will still do enough to outperform the broader market in the near future. If not, then existing shareholders may be quite nervous about the viability of the share price.

Is There Enough Growth For Urovo Technology?

The only time you'd be truly comfortable seeing a P/E as high as Urovo Technology's is when the company's growth is on track to outshine the market.

Taking a look back first, the company's earnings per share growth last year wasn't something to get excited about as it posted a disappointing decline of 28%. This has erased any of its gains during the last three years, with practically no change in EPS being achieved in total. So it appears to us that the company has had a mixed result in terms of growing earnings over that time.

Weighing that recent medium-term earnings trajectory against the broader market's one-year forecast for expansion of 42% shows it's noticeably less attractive on an annualised basis.

In light of this, it's alarming that Urovo Technology's P/E sits above the majority of other companies. Apparently many investors in the company are way more bullish than recent times would indicate and aren't willing to let go of their stock at any price. There's a good chance existing shareholders are setting themselves up for future disappointment if the P/E falls to levels more in line with recent growth rates.

What We Can Learn From Urovo Technology's P/E?

Urovo Technology's P/E hasn't come down all the way after its stock plunged. It's argued the price-to-earnings ratio is an inferior measure of value within certain industries, but it can be a powerful business sentiment indicator.

We've established that Urovo Technology currently trades on a much higher than expected P/E since its recent three-year growth is lower than the wider market forecast. When we see weak earnings with slower than market growth, we suspect the share price is at risk of declining, sending the high P/E lower. Unless the recent medium-term conditions improve markedly, it's very challenging to accept these prices as being reasonable.
